Output 8b8ca151a78cb8bb0c181555f54759a92c671410c1c6d7d2c907b870f16fa88e:0

value
1708810
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40623b0a84119199993f89e58a6bb5bc9e4fc89b OP_EQUAL
address
37ZSr1DyA3ijXKfgBF6a3V5tFvSVBXFkf4
transaction
8b8ca151a78cb8bb0c181555f54759a92c671410c1c6d7d2c907b870f16fa88e
spent
true